I have a couple of new AOpen boards, each with a single Kingston PC2700 333MHz 256Mb DIMM stick. 
At start-up, both boards report the memory operating at 266MHz, in spite of the DIMMs being
specified as 333MHz. 
I was hoping decode-dimms would help me determine what the SPD says about this, but "Intel
Frequency Specification" comes out as "Undefined!" ...

This is the decode-dimms output (in HTML format):  http://jessen.ch/files/spd-decoded

Can someone help me point the finger at either Kingston or AOpen?
